The following sentences has two blanks. Fill in the blanks with appropriate forms of the word given in brackets.
I didn’t notice any serious_________ of opinion among the debaters, although they_________ from one another over small points. (differ)
Advertisements
Solution
I didn’t notice any serious difference of opinion among the debaters, although they differed from one another over small points.
